Drug resistant P. falciparum in Madras (Tamil Nadu) and district Jabalpur (Madhya Pradesh).

S K Ghosh, D S Choudhury, R K Chandrahas, N Singh, T V Ramanaiah, V P Sharma.   

Abstract

WHO micro in vitro tests for chloroquine resistance in P. falciparum were carried out during November, 1987 in Madras city, Tamil Nadu and in Kundam PHC of Jabalpur district, Madhya Pradesh. Out of 6 samples tested from Madras city, 5 showed resistance to chloroquine. Likewise, out of 14 samples tested in Jabalpur, 12 (85.7%) showed resistance to chloroquine. All the 20 samples showed normal susceptibility to mefloquine.
